The Phoenix Rises!
My first car, bought at the age of 18 for $750. It had a front wing torn off, but with headlights on the bonnet it was legal after I made a tin mudguard. I saved up and bought a fibreglass front and it started to look OK - but wasn't exactly the chick magnet I expected... especially when raining. Socks stuffed along the top of the windscreen and folded newspapers between the windscreen and the dash!
My first car club event was a mud sprint and I did OK. Then came the MG Car Club's Lanac Park dirt circuit (pictured). But one day, coming home from an event, a drunk drove straight out in front of me and I t-boned him. I slipped out of my lap sash belt and my face hit the wheel. Couldn't afford to fix the horn so I had glued a nice plastic Austin badge in the centre... which I demolished with my face. (Pic attached) Woke up in the Royal Adelaide and spent a month there getting nurse's phone numbers.
Surprisingly I got some insurance money and the front was professionally rebuilt (pics attached). It looked brand new - until I went mad and fitted 1.5 inch SU's and discovered that I had to cut a hole in the bonnet to close it! Ah well, it was just the start of my "motorsport learnings".
Eventually I upgraded to an MGB (which DID attract the chicks) and after spending $5000 on the Sprite I sold it for.... $750...
